I have asked about this over the years as Bangkok is sinking much like other major cities in Asia. China has the same problem and they have banned people from drawing ground water in certain cities. Also adding all that concrete does not help by adding so much weight to the surface. There was talk about moving North to Ayutthaya but that was many years ago to get out of the valley that Bangkok is located in.
Nobody I have ever met has thought it possible as you needs loads of money and some people would not like the idea of downgrading Bangkok to a lesser city and lower the value of their property investments. Time will tell but this is the first time that I know of that someone of note has brought it up.

I know there are some Christians here. My wife and her family are Christian. But, she has never heard of the Pope. Are there alot of Catholics here? There are only about 750,000 Christians, from what I hear. How many of those are Catholic? Seems an odd place to visit.
In 2003, there were 278,000 Catholics in Thailand, which constituted 0.44% of the total population at the time.
As of 2018, there are 379,975 Catholics in Thailand, a figure that represents 0.46 percent of the total population of 69 million.
